Abstract

The purpose of this study is to conduct an empirical investigation on academic performance of freshman students of the Faculty of Science , AAU. A random sample of 772 students have been selected from those students who have been enrolled in the Faculty in academic years 1995/96, 1996/97,1997/98 and 1999/2000. The students have beell.9rouped into two 51rala; Addis_ Ababa _and out-of-Addis Ababa region. Non-parametric Statistical methods such as Wilcoxon and Ansari-Bradley two sample tests, Lepage test and Spearman coefficient of correlation based on ranks were used to analyse the data. The results revealed that at a 0.01 degree of assurance there is no significant difference in performance between the two groups students at freshman level. The resu lts of the analysis also showed that there is a significant correlation between ESLCE GPA and freshman GPA.
